Angels call up six players from minor leagues to fill roster

The Angels selected the contract of infielder Kyren Paris from Double-A Rocket City and recalled left-hander Kolton Ingram, right-handed pitchers Jimmy Herget, Gerardo Reyes and Andrew Wantz and infielder Michael Stefanic from Triple-A Salt Lake. Angels put unvaccinated Taylor Ward, Aaron Loup, Ryan Tepera on restricted list before series in Toronto

Foreign nationals who aren’t vaccinated against COVID-19 aren’t allowed to enter Canada, save for limited exceptions that require a 14-day quarantine. Unvaccinated baseball players are placed on the restricted list, where they are not paid and do not accrue major league service time. Loup will lose $123,626, Tepera $115,385 and Ward $11,868.
